Has anyone seen an (http error 404) when trying to update Internet security 2008? This is running on Windows XP in a Parallel virtual machine on a MacBook Pro.

aaaaaaaaaah here we go!! (IMG:http://forum.bitdefender.com/style_emoticons/default/smile.gif)
I used http://update.bitdefender.com but with no luckk same error appeared but used:
http://upgrade1.bitdefender.com as Primary
http://upgrade2.bitdefender.com
and updates downloaded successfully (IMG:http://forum.bitdefender.com/style_emoticons/default/smile.gif)
Maybe the Default server is having problems with my location...I don't know
Note that: I don't think that the updates available in the site include the plugins updates..I think it only include virus definitions...

It really doesn't matter. Even if there are some small delays between the servers (caused by synchronization delays), eventually all servers will deliver the same updates for all products, and the delays are not bigger than one hour. (IMG:style_emoticons/default/smile.gif)
